1. Canva
Almost a blank canvas, but with many features for illustrating.
In fact, Canva is one of the most used visual content tools.
With easy operation, it allows you to create pieces for social media and blog posts, as well as infographics, social networks profiles cover burkina faso leads photos, among several other possibilities.
You can also insert icons, choose fonts, and edit images for a better result.
It’s a complete tool, especially for those who have no experience in more advanced software like Photoshop and Illustrator.
Plans and features
You have access to over 8,000 templates and over 100 design types, photos, and graphics in the free version.

2. Design Wizard
Another great editing tool, Design Wizard, allows you to quickly and easily customize image and video layouts. All this with a large media library.
Users have access to a selection of more than one million high-quality images and video templates to use in their blog posts. The editing features are very intuitive and make the process very fast.
The software also offers integrations with essential routine tools such as Marketo, Buffer, and Hubspot.
Plans and features
In the free version, you pay for videos and images as you download them, besides resizing tools, adding text and images to templates, and other features.
